About Anton A. Komar

Anton A. Komar is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Hematology,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Cell Biology and Neurology, having authored 110 papers that have together received 5.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(65 papers), RNA modifications and cancer (39 papers), RNA Research and Splicing (37 papers), Viral Infections and Immunology Research (12 papers), RNA regulation and disease (10 papers), Prion Diseases and Protein Misfolding (7 papers),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(6 papers) and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(4.9k citations), Cell Biology (490 citations), Cancer Research (368 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(550 citations) and Genetics (618 citations). Anton A. Komar has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Maria Hatzoglou, William C. Merrick, Thierry Lesnik, Claude Reiss, Marina V. Rodnina, Tatyana V. Pestova, Christopher U.T. Hellen, George W. Rogers, Barsanjit Mazumder and Sujata Jha.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Molecular and Cellular Biology, Nucleic Acids Research, FEBS Letters and RNA.
